Professor A. Garkavi, MD I.M. Sechenov First Moscow State Medical University (Sechenov University)

Undesirable adverse reactions associated with therapy with n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s in patients with osteoarthritis can be minimized by a combination of oral administration of the above drugs and topical Dolgit® gel applications.
